{"id":3686,"date":"2025-02-07T12:31:00","date_gmt":"2025-02-07T07:01:00","guid":{"rendered":"https:\/\/metamatrixtech.com\/blogs\/?p=3686"},"modified":"2025-02-07T14:18:30","modified_gmt":"2025-02-07T08:48:30","slug":"blockchain-integration-in-web-development-use-cases-and-challenges","status":"publish","type":"post","link":"https:\/\/metamatrixtech.com\/blogs\/2025\/02\/07\/blockchain-integration-in-web-development-use-cases-and-challenges\/","title":{"rendered":"Blockchain Integration in Web Development: Use Cases and Challenges"},"content":{"rendered":"\n<h3 class=\"wp-block-heading\"><em>How Blockchain is Enhancing Security, Transparency, and Trust in Web Applications<\/em><\/h3>\n\n\n\n<p>Blockchain technology is <strong>revolutionizing web development<\/strong>, bringing <strong>unparalleled security, transparency, and decentralization<\/strong> to online platforms. As cyber threats grow and users demand <strong>greater control over their data<\/strong>, developers are increasingly integrating blockchain into <strong>web applications, financial services, and digital identity solutions<\/strong>.<\/p>\n\n\n\n<p>While blockchain offers <strong>immense benefits<\/strong>, it also presents <strong>technical challenges<\/strong> that developers must overcome. This article explores <strong>real-world use cases, key benefits, and obstacles<\/strong> in adopting blockchain for web development.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\"\/>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>1. Why Blockchain is Transforming Web Development<\/strong><\/h2>\n\n\n\n<p>\ud83d\udd10 <strong>Enhanced Security:<\/strong> Data stored on a blockchain is <strong>immutable<\/strong>, meaning it cannot be altered or hacked easily.<\/p>\n\n\n\n<p>\ud83c\udf0d <strong>Decentralization:<\/strong> Unlike traditional web applications that rely on <strong>centralized servers<\/strong>, blockchain-based platforms distribute data <strong>across multiple nodes<\/strong>, reducing the risk of <strong>server failures and data breaches<\/strong>.<\/p>\n\n\n\n<p>\ud83d\udcca <strong>Transparency &amp; Trust:<\/strong> Every transaction on a blockchain is <strong>recorded publicly<\/strong> and can be <strong>verified in real-time<\/strong>, increasing <strong>trust in digital transactions<\/strong>.<\/p>\n\n\n\n<p>\u26a1 <strong>Smart Contracts:<\/strong> These self-executing contracts <strong>automate processes<\/strong> without requiring intermediaries, making transactions <strong>faster and cost-effective<\/strong>.<\/p>\n\n\n\n<p>\ud83d\udccc <strong>Example:<\/strong> Ethereum\u2019s smart contracts are widely used in <strong>DeFi (Decentralized Finance), NFT marketplaces, and supply chain tracking<\/strong>.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\"\/>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>2. Key Use Cases of Blockchain in Web Development<\/strong><\/h2>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>\ud83d\udee1\ufe0f 2.1 Secure Identity Verification &amp; Authentication<\/strong><\/h3>\n\n\n\n<p>Traditional login systems are <strong>vulnerable to data breaches and password theft<\/strong>. Blockchain-based authentication eliminates the need for <strong>passwords<\/strong> by using <strong>decentralized digital identities (DIDs)<\/strong>.<\/p>\n\n\n\n<p>\u2705 <strong>Decentralized Identity Management:<\/strong> Users store their credentials on a <strong>blockchain wallet<\/strong>, reducing the risk of hacks.<br>\u2705 <strong>Single Sign-On (SSO):<\/strong> Enables <strong>password-free logins<\/strong> with blockchain-based authentication.<\/p>\n\n\n\n<p>\ud83d\udccc <strong>Example:<\/strong> Microsoft\u2019s <strong>ION<\/strong> is a decentralized identity system built on the Bitcoin blockchain.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\"\/>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>\ud83d\udcb0 2.2 Decentralized Payment Systems<\/strong><\/h3>\n\n\n\n<p>Blockchain-powered payment solutions eliminate the need for <strong>banks or third-party payment processors<\/strong>, reducing transaction fees and processing time.<\/p>\n\n\n\n<p>\u2705 <strong>Cryptocurrency Payments:<\/strong> Websites can integrate <strong>Bitcoin, Ethereum, or stablecoins<\/strong> as payment options.<br>\u2705 <strong>Cross-Border Transactions:<\/strong> Blockchain enables <strong>fast, low-cost international payments<\/strong>.<br>\u2705 <strong>Micropayments:<\/strong> Ideal for <strong>subscription models and pay-per-use web applications<\/strong>.<\/p>\n\n\n\n<p>\ud83d\udccc <strong>Example:<\/strong> Shopify allows merchants to accept <strong>crypto payments<\/strong> through blockchain-powered payment gateways like BitPay.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\"\/>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>\ud83d\udcdd 2.3 Smart Contracts for Automated Transactions<\/strong><\/h3>\n\n\n\n<p>Smart contracts eliminate the need for <strong>middlemen<\/strong> in <strong>financial transactions, agreements, and business processes<\/strong>.<\/p>\n\n\n\n<p>\u2705 <strong>Self-Executing Agreements:<\/strong> Transactions occur <strong>only when predefined conditions<\/strong> are met.<br>\u2705 <strong>Tamper-Proof Records:<\/strong> No single entity can <strong>alter or manipulate the contract<\/strong> once deployed.<br>\u2705 <strong>Use Cases:<\/strong> <strong>Real estate transactions, insurance claims, and supply chain automation<\/strong>.<\/p>\n\n\n\n<p>\ud83d\udccc <strong>Example:<\/strong> OpenLaw enables <strong>legal agreements through smart contracts<\/strong>, automating contract execution.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\"\/>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>\ud83c\udfad 2.4 NFTs &amp; Digital Asset Management<\/strong><\/h3>\n\n\n\n<p>Non-Fungible Tokens (NFTs) have created a <strong>new market for digital assets<\/strong>, allowing users to buy, sell, and prove ownership of <strong>art, music, collectibles, and virtual goods<\/strong>.<\/p>\n\n\n\n<p>\u2705 <strong>Ownership Verification:<\/strong> Ensures <strong>authenticity and uniqueness<\/strong> of digital assets.<br>\u2705 <strong>Royalties &amp; Creator Rights:<\/strong> Artists receive <strong>automatic royalties<\/strong> via smart contracts.<br>\u2705 <strong>Decentralized Marketplaces:<\/strong> Platforms like <strong>OpenSea<\/strong> and <strong>Rarible<\/strong> operate on blockchain technology.<\/p>\n\n\n\n<p>\ud83d\udccc <strong>Example:<\/strong> NBA Top Shot allows fans to <strong>buy and trade blockchain-based sports highlights<\/strong>.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\"\/>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>\ud83d\udce6 2.5 Supply Chain Transparency<\/strong><\/h3>\n\n\n\n<p>Blockchain provides <strong>real-time tracking<\/strong> and <strong>immutable records<\/strong> for supply chain management.<\/p>\n\n\n\n<p>\u2705 <strong>Product Provenance:<\/strong> Tracks <strong>origin and authenticity<\/strong> of goods.<br>\u2705 <strong>Eliminating Counterfeits:<\/strong> Blockchain ensures only <strong>verified suppliers and products<\/strong> enter the supply chain.<br>\u2705 <strong>Efficient Logistics:<\/strong> Automates inventory tracking and shipment updates.<\/p>\n\n\n\n<p>\ud83d\udccc <strong>Example:<\/strong> Walmart uses blockchain to <strong>track food products<\/strong> and improve <strong>food safety and recall efficiency<\/strong>.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\"\/>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>3. Challenges of Blockchain Integration in Web Development<\/strong><\/h2>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>\u26a1 3.1 Scalability Issues<\/strong><\/h3>\n\n\n\n<p>\ud83d\udd3b <strong>Blockchains process transactions slower<\/strong> than traditional databases.<br>\ud83d\udd3b <strong>Ethereum and Bitcoin networks face congestion<\/strong>, leading to high transaction fees.<\/p>\n\n\n\n<p>\u2705 <strong>Solution:<\/strong> <strong>Layer 2 solutions like Polygon, Optimistic Rollups, and sidechains<\/strong> improve scalability.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\"\/>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>\ud83d\udcb0 3.2 High Development Costs<\/strong><\/h3>\n\n\n\n<p>\ud83d\udd3b <strong>Blockchain integration requires specialized developers<\/strong>, increasing development costs.<br>\ud83d\udd3b <strong>Gas fees (transaction costs on blockchain networks) can be expensive<\/strong>.<\/p>\n\n\n\n<p>\u2705 <strong>Solution:<\/strong> Use <strong>cost-effective blockchains<\/strong> like <strong>Solana, Binance Smart Chain, or Avalanche<\/strong>.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\"\/>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>\ud83d\udd0d 3.3 Regulatory Uncertainty<\/strong><\/h3>\n\n\n\n<p>\ud83d\udd3b Governments are still <strong>defining regulations<\/strong> for blockchain and cryptocurrencies.<br>\ud83d\udd3b <strong>Legal compliance varies<\/strong> across countries, creating uncertainty for businesses.<\/p>\n\n\n\n<p>\u2705 <strong>Solution:<\/strong> Businesses should follow <strong>KYC (Know Your Customer) and AML (Anti-Money Laundering) compliance guidelines<\/strong>.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\"\/>\n\n\n\n<h3 class=\"wp-block-heading\"><strong>\ud83d\udd17 3.4 Limited Interoperability<\/strong><\/h3>\n\n\n\n<p>\ud83d\udd3b <strong>Different blockchains<\/strong> (Ethereum, Solana, Binance Smart Chain) <strong>don\u2019t always communicate seamlessly<\/strong>.<\/p>\n\n\n\n<p>\u2705 <strong>Solution:<\/strong> Cross-chain protocols like <strong>Polkadot and Cosmos<\/strong> enable <strong>blockchain interoperability<\/strong>.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\"\/>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>4. The Future of Blockchain in Web Development<\/strong><\/h2>\n\n\n\n<p>\ud83d\ude80 <strong>Blockchain Will Power More Web3 Applications:<\/strong> The transition from <strong>Web2 (centralized) to Web3 (decentralized)<\/strong> will accelerate.<\/p>\n\n\n\n<p>\ud83d\udd17 <strong>Interoperability Between Blockchains Will Improve:<\/strong> Cross-chain platforms will enable <strong>seamless interaction between different blockchain networks<\/strong>.<\/p>\n\n\n\n<p>\ud83d\udcdc <strong>Smart Contracts Will Become More Advanced:<\/strong> They will handle <strong>complex workflows in finance, legal, and business applications<\/strong>.<\/p>\n\n\n\n<p>\ud83c\udf0d <strong>Regulatory Frameworks Will Stabilize:<\/strong> Governments will establish <strong>clearer guidelines<\/strong>, encouraging broader adoption.<\/p>\n\n\n\n<hr class=\"wp-block-separator has-alpha-channel-opacity\"\/>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Final Thoughts: Should You Integrate Blockchain Into Your Web App?<\/strong><\/h2>\n\n\n\n<p>Blockchain is <strong>not just a buzzword<\/strong>\u2014it\u2019s <strong>a game-changer<\/strong> in web development. While challenges exist, its benefits in <strong>security, transparency, and decentralization<\/strong> make it a <strong>valuable tool<\/strong> for web applications.<\/p>\n\n\n\n<p>If you\u2019re building a <strong>web app that requires high security, data integrity, or decentralized payments<\/strong>, blockchain <strong>can be a great fit<\/strong>. However, for applications <strong>requiring high-speed transactions and real-time data processing<\/strong>, traditional databases might still be the better option.<\/p>\n\n\n\n<p>The <strong>key takeaway?<\/strong> As blockchain matures, its role in web development will only grow\u2014making <strong>now the perfect time<\/strong> for developers and businesses to explore its potential.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>How Blockchain is Enhancing Security, Transparency, and Trust in Web Applications Blockchain technology is revolutionizing web development, bringing unparalleled security, transparency, and decentralization to online platforms. As cyber threats grow and users demand greater control over their data, developers are increasingly integrating blockchain into web applications, financial services, and digital identity solutions. While blockchain offers [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":3687,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1],"tags":[347,596,567,281,302,593,348,594,345,50,595],"class_list":["post-3686","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-uncategorized","tag-blockchain","tag-crypto-payments","tag-cryptography","tag-cybersecurity","tag-data-security","tag-decentralized-applications","tag-defi","tag-ethereum","tag-nfts","tag-smart-contracts","tag-web3"],"blocksy_meta":[],"_links":{"self":[{"href":"https:\/\/metamatrixtech.com\/blogs\/wp-json\/wp\/v2\/posts\/3686","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/metamatrixtech.com\/blogs\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/metamatrixtech.com\/blogs\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/metamatrixtech.com\/blogs\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/metamatrixtech.com\/blogs\/wp-json\/wp\/v2\/comments?post=3686"}],"version-history":[{"count":1,"href":"https:\/\/metamatrixtech.com\/blogs\/wp-json\/wp\/v2\/posts\/3686\/revisions"}],"predecessor-version":[{"id":3688,"href":"https:\/\/metamatrixtech.com\/blogs\/wp-json\/wp\/v2\/posts\/3686\/revisions\/3688"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/metamatrixtech.com\/blogs\/wp-json\/wp\/v2\/media\/3687"}],"wp:attachment":[{"href":"https:\/\/metamatrixtech.com\/blogs\/wp-json\/wp\/v2\/media?parent=3686"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/metamatrixtech.com\/blogs\/wp-json\/wp\/v2\/categories?post=3686"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/metamatrixtech.com\/blogs\/wp-json\/wp\/v2\/tags?post=3686"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}